Block Wall Repair in Cleveland, OH
Block wall rep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the structural integrity of masonry walls built with concrete blocks, cinder blocks, or similar materials. These projects often involve fixing cracks, replacing damaged or fallen blocks, addressing bowing or leaning sections, and sealing joints to prevent water intrusion. Homeowners typically request this service to improve the safety, appearance, and durability of boundary walls, retaining walls, garden enclosures, or decorative features on their property.
Before requesting block wall rep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of damage, the causes behind it, and the best methods for repair. It’s important to assess whether issues stem from settling, water damage, or age-related deterioration. Clear communication about the condition of the wall can help determine if repairs are sufficient or if more extensive work may be needed in the future. Proper evaluation ensures that the repairs will reinforce the wall’s stability and extend its lifespan.

Common Block Wall Repair Jobs
Block wall repair - addresses cracks and damaged mortar to restore stability.
Retaining wall fixes - reinforces or rebuilds for proper support and durability.
Cracked wall restoration - fills and seals cracks to prevent further deterioration.
Leaning or bowing walls - stabilizes and straightens to maintain structural integrity.
Masonry patching - repairs chips, holes, and surface damage for a uniform appearance.
Complete wall rebuilding - replaces severely damaged sections to ensure safety and longevity.
Block Wall Repair Questions
What types of block wall damage require repair? Common issues include cracking, bowing, leaning, or missing blocks that compromise stability and appearance.
How can I tell if my block wall needs repair? Visible cracks, uneven surfaces, or water leaks are signs that a wall may need professional attention.
Are there different repair options for block walls? Yes, repairs may include re-mortaring, replacing damaged blocks, or reinforcing the structure depending on the damage.
What are common causes of block wall damage? Causes include soil pressure, settling, freeze-thaw cycles, and poor initial construction or drainage issues.
